Spring News


MET Studio is proud to announce the royal opening of the Budongo Trail Chimpanzee exhibit by HRH The Princess Royal.
MET Studio have worked in conjunction with the RZSS and Cooper Cromar architects over the last two years to design and build this world class Chimpanzee enclosure. The exhibition focuses on the conservation effort currently taking place in the Budongo forest, Uganda by introducing visitors to the tireless efforts being made in the preservation of our closest cousins, the wonder and awe of their environment and the varied and intricate personalities they possess. The exhibit has already been billed as one of Europe’s leading zoological interpretational experiences.

Spring News


An exhibition put together by soldiers to depict their experiences fighting the Taliban has been nominated for the Art Fund Prize (Ben Hoyle writes). Helmand: The Soldiers' Story, at the National Army Museum, Chelsea, is one of ten projects and institutions being considered for the £100,000 prize. More than 150 soldiers from 16 Air Assault Brigade contributed to the exhibition, which tells the story of their tour of duty in Afghanistan in 2006.

Autumn News


Met Studio has recently completed its work for a unique exhibition that is now open at the National Army Museum. HELMAND: The Soldiers’ Story has been built, written and contributed to by soldiers of 16 Air Assault Brigade, to tell the story of their experiences fighting in Afghanistan’s troubled Helmand Province in 2006.
